π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

14 items
  • 1 cup Basmati or long-grain rice
  • 2 cups Water
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 cup Cherry tomatoes
  • 1 medium Cucumber
  • 1 Red bell pepper
  • 0.5 Red onion
  • 0.25 cup Fresh parsley
  • 0.25 cup Fresh mint
  • 3 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 3 tablespoons Lemon juice
  • 0.25 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 0.5 cup Feta cheese (optional)
  • 0.5 cup Cooked chickpeas (optional)

πŸ“ Instructions

9 steps
1

Rinse the rice under cold water to remove excess starch, then add it to a medium saucepan with 2 cups of water and 0.5 teaspoon of salt.

2

Bring the water to a boil, then reduce the heat to low, cover, and let the rice simmer until fully cooked (about 12-15 minutes). Once done, fluff the rice with a fork and set it aside to cool completely.

3

While the rice cools, prepare the vegetables: halve the cherry tomatoes, dice the cucumber and red bell pepper into small pieces, and finely chop the red onion.

4

Chop the parsley and mint leaves finely.

5

In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, lemon juice, 0.25 teaspoon of salt, and black pepper to create the dressing.

6

Once the rice has fully cooled, transfer it to a large bowl. Add the chopped vegetables, parsley, and mint.

7

Pour the dressing over the salad and gently toss everything together until evenly mixed. If desired, fold in crumbled feta cheese or cooked chickpeas for added protein.

8

Taste the salad and adjust the seasoning with additional salt or pepper if needed.

9

Serve immediately or refrigerate for 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ld. Serve chilled or at room temperature.

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(386.6g)
Calories
305
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 17.8 g 23%
Saturated Fat 6.2 g 31%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 27 mg 9%
Sodium 596 mg 26%
Total Carbohydrate 28.6 g 10%
Dietary Fiber 4.6 g 17%
Total Sugars 6.2 g
Protein 9.7 g 19%
Vitamin D 0.0 mcg 0%
Calcium 244 mg 19%
Iron 3.5 mg 19%
Potassium 460 mg 10%
